This service addresses several common problems associated with Japanese Barberry. The shrub is known for its ability to spread rapidly, forming dense thickets that crowd out native species and disrupt local ecosystems. It can also pose hazards by creating thick, thorny barriers that limit access to certain areas or pose a risk to children and pets. Additionally, the dense growth can lead to increased pest activity and reduce airflow around other plants, making it harder for a garden or yard to thrive. Removing Japanese Barberry helps restore natural plant diversity and improves overall landscape safety and aesthetics.

The overview below groups typical Japanese Barberry Removal proj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in San Rafael, CA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Removal Jobs - For routine Japanese Barberry removal on smaller properties, local contractors typically charge between $250 and $600. Many projects fall within this range, especially for limited infestations or partial removal efforts.
Medium-Scale Projects - Larger areas or more extensive infestations usually cost between $600 and $1,500. These projects often involve multiple visits or more detailed work, which can increase the overall cost.
Full Property Removal - Complete removal from an entire yard or landscape can range from $1,500 to $3,000. Such projects are common for homeowners seeking thorough eradication and landscape restoration.
Large or Complex Jobs - Larger, more complex projects, such as dealing with dense infestations or difficult terrain, can reach $5,000 or more. These are less common but may be necessary for severe cases requiring specialized equipment or extensive labor.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are the signs of Japanese Barberry infestation? Signs include dense clusters of thorny shrubs with reddish stems and bright red berries, often spreading into unwanted areas of a property.
Why should Japanese Barberry removal be handled by professionals? Professionals have the expertise and tools to effectively remove the plants and prevent regrowth, reducing the risk of spreading to other parts of the landscape.
Are there specific methods used to remove Japanese Barberry? Yes, local contractors typically use mechanical removal or targeted herbicide treatments to eliminate Japanese Barberry safely and effectively.
Can Japanese Barberry be removed without damaging nearby plants? Yes, experienced service providers can carefully remove Japanese Barberry to minimize impact on surrounding vegetation.
How do local contractors ensure Japanese Barberry does not return? They often implement follow-up treatments and proper disposal methods to reduce the chance of regrowth and spread.
